Resolution
WHEREAS, a major finding of the Comprehensive Master Plan for the
Elderly, commissioned by the 1974 State Legislature, indicates that
the most pressing problem facing the elderly is retirement income which
assures a decent standard of living;.and
WHEREAS, this concern is alarming and depressing since our Nation's
elderly worked hard in their productive years so that subsequent
generations could enjoy the fruits of their labors; and
WHEREAS, Social Security benefits are the chief source of income
for the elderly, however, inflation has eroded the purchasing power and
has forced many of our elderly to lower their standard of living; and
WHEREAS, there has been a move at the Nation's Capitol to eliminate
the Social Security cost of living adjustment and to tax one-half of the
Social Security benefits as income, such an act results in imposing
additional hardships upon the elderly.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E COUNTY OF
HAWAII that it opposes any move to reduce or tax Social Security
benefits which our Nation's elderly depend upon for a decent standard
of living.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Clerk of the County of Hawaii
transmit copies of this resolution to the Honorable Jimmy Carter,
President of the United States; the Honorable Daniel K. Inouye,
U. S. Senator; the Honorable Spark M. Matsunaga, U. S. Senator; the
Honorable Daniel K. Akaka, U. S. Congressman and the Honorable Cecil
Heftel, U. S. Congressman.
